East Women's Division 1S

Colchester 3 Folkestone 2

In their final game before the Christmas break Colchester came back twice from behind to beat Folkestone 3-2 on Saturday.

The home side started poorly and were under constant pressure for the opening ten minutes. Having failed to clear their lines on several occasions it was only a matter of time before Folkestone took the lead. Colchester slowly started to play themselves back into the game with their reward coming near the end of the first half when an Anna Foley free hit from just outside the 'D' was touched in by Helen Peters.

The second half continued with both teams playing at pace, but it was again the visitors who took advantage after a sweeping move from within their own half resulted in an unmarked player powerfully slotting away from close range, giving Folkestone a 2-1 lead.

Colchester refused to give up and their attacking moves were rewarded with numerous penalty corners. The equaliser came from one such penalty corner where a miss-hit strike fell fortuitously for Mel Cooper who powered in from close range.

With the score at 2-2, and not long left on the clock, Colchester pushed once more and grabbed the winner from another penalty corner, where Louise Bibby was once again on hand to neatly strike the ball past the Folkestone keeper. A delighted Colchester now go into the break comfortably sitting mid table.
